Can anyone tell me what the differences are between Carbonetic's twin disc "Standard" (street and track) and "Type R" (drag) clutches?

It's not the pressure plate because both Standard and Type R come with either an 1100kg or 1350kg pressure plate. It's not the lw flywheel either since they both come with it as well.

Really impatient right now and Carbonetic is closed today and maybe Monday since it's MLK Day...What could "drag" mean in comparison to "street and track", how different could it be.
